I believe that everyone should have a Food Babe Kitchen in their own home. That’s why I’m sharing my complete pantry list with you. It includes everything you’d find if you went to my house and raided my pantry and fridge.
I made sure to include the brand names that I personally buy and love to use. There are a lot of other good organic brands that may not be mentioned, along with store brands (such as Thrive Market, Trader Joe’s, and Whole Foods 365) that I also choose, so this list is not exhaustive. I also purchase some of these items from organic bulk bins in my grocery store. My primary criteria when choosing a product is that it is certified organic.
I highly recommend using my list as a guide and then creating a list of your own with your favorite brands or things that you like to stock in your pantry. Keep a copy of it on your fridge or inside your pantry door. Simply check off anything that needs to be replaced each week, which will make it easy for you to build your grocery shopping list. Have this list handy on your computer so you can make copies of it or get fancy and laminate it to use with a dry erase marker to circle what you need to buy. My hope is that this will help you navigate the grocery store with ease and stay organized. When your pantry is stocked for success, it’s so much easier to plan and cook healthful meals at home.
Important Note: All products listed below are USDA Certified Organic when applicable. Some brands make similar non-organic products, and if so, choose the organic version whenever possible. Look for the USDA Organic seal on the product to verify.
